本文主要是介绍Django_急速掌握003 -- 设置数据库,希望对大家解决编程问题提供一定的参考价值,需要的开发者们随着小编来一起学习吧!
由于初始化时django不会自动新建mysql的数据库,所以连接数据库之前,必须先手动新建起来。
对于啥也不懂的小白来说使用Navicat来管理你的mysql数据库是比较好的选择。打卡Navicat之后,新建一个mysql的链接,然后新建一个数据库,比如命名为DataBaseForTest,这种做法比使用命令行省事。
接下来回到你的pycharm里的Django项目。
打开YourPorjectName/ YourPorjectName里的settings.py,再找到DATABASES变量,然后改成这个样子:
DATABASES = {
'default': {
'ENGINE': 'django.db.backends.mysql',
'NAME': databasefortest, # 你的数据库名称
'USER': 'root', # 你的数据库用户名
'PASSWORD': 'YourMysqlUserPW, # 你的数据库密码
'HOST': '', # 你的数据库主机,留空默认为localhost
'PORT': '3306', # 你的数据库端口,默认是3306
}
}
后面两个可以不用写,只有需要修改主机和端口时才写
数据的具体设置方法参见https://docs.djangoproject.com/en/2.1/ref/settings/#databases
这篇关于Django_急速掌握003 -- 设置数据库的文章就介绍到这儿,希望我们推荐的文章对编程师们有所帮助!